LAS VEGAS — Marcus & Millichap has arranged the $27.8 million sale of a 16,016-square-foot Walgreens, located at 3025 S. Law Vegas Blvd. on the Las Vegas strip. At a sale price of $1,736 per square foot, it is the most valuable single-tenant drugstore to ever trade in the U.S. Ray Germain of Marcus & Millichap's Las Vegas office represented the seller, a local real estate investment partnership, in the transaction. Sean Shahar Ziv of the firm's San Diego office represented the buyer, a foreign fund. Walgreens was in the 11th year of a 20-year, triple-net lease and prior to the close of escrow Germain negotiated an additional 10-year extension.

BETHESDA, MD. — Silverspot has signed a 50,000-square-foot lease at the 1 million-square-foot Rock Spring Centre, a mixed-use development located along Old Georgtown Road and Rock Spring Drive in Bethesda. The Peterson Cos. and DRI Development Services plan to break ground this summer on the project, which will include 549,900 square feet of office space, 210,000 square feet of retail space, the 12-screen Silverspot movie theater, a 40,000-square-foot health club, a 200-room hotel and 161 residential units. Silverspot, which is slated for completion in spring 2014, will offer a full-service cafe and bar, lounge area and concession stand. Bill Miller and Alex Walker of Transwestern represented the development team in the transaction. Mathew Focht and Sierra Group represented the tenant.
